The genus Senecio comprises approximately 1500 species worldwide, with over 60 species distributed throughout China. These plants have been widely used in traditional Chinese medicine to treat various conditions including inflammation, eye diseases, vaginal trichomoniasis, and acute urinary tract infections. What is the plant called Senecio?

Senecio is a genus of flowering plants in the daisy family (Asteraceae) that includes groundsels and some ragworts. Variously circumscribed taxonomically, the genus Senecio is one of the largest genera of flowering plants. Plants of the World Online currently accepts 1482 species.
